Canada Student Visa from Bangladesh – Requirements & Eligibility
To successfully obtain a Canada student visa from Bangladesh, you must fulfill IRCC’s academic, financial, and personal requirements. Applying for a Canada student visa from Bangladesh has become increasingly popular due to Canada’s high-quality education and welcoming immigration system.
Here is the complete breakdown:
1. Letter of Acceptance (LOA)
A Letter of Acceptance (LOA) is an official document issued by a designated learning institution (DLI) in Canada confirming that a student has been accepted into a full-time academic program. It includes key details such as the program name, duration, start date, tuition fees, and any conditions that must be met before enrollment. This document is essential for applying for a Canadian study permit. You must first receive an acceptance letter from a Designated Learning Institution (DLI) in Canada.
2. IELTS or PTE Score (English Proficiency)
To study in Canada, international students must meet the English proficiency requirements set by their chosen institution. This is typically demonstrated through standardized tests such as IELTS, TOEFL, PTE, or Duolingo. Each institution sets its own minimum score based on the program level, ensuring students can successfully participate in academic activities and communicate effectively in an English-speaking environment. English test requirements vary by program.
Minimum Requirement
-
IELTS Academic: 6.0 (no band less than 5.5)
-
PTE Academic: 60+
-
TOEFL iBT: 80+
Recommended Scores
-
Diploma: IELTS 6.0
-
Bachelor’s: 6.5
-
Master’s: 6.5–7.0
3. GIC Requirement (Financial Readiness)
The Guaranteed Investment Certificate (GIC) is a mandatory financial requirement for international students applying through Canada’s Student Direct Stream (SDS). It serves as proof that the student has sufficient funds to cover their living expenses for the first year in Canada. Students must purchase a GIC, typically valued at CAD 20,635, from a participating Canadian financial institution, ensuring financial stability upon arrival. The required Guaranteed Investment Certificate (GIC) amount for 2025 is:
CAD $20,635
This amount covers your living expenses for the first year in Canada.
4. Tuition Fee Payment
For international students studying in Canada, paying a portion of the tuition fees in advance is a key requirement for securing admission and strengthening the study permit application. Most designated learning institutions (DLIs) require students to pay the first semester or first-year tuition as proof of financial readiness. This payment demonstrates commitment to the program and helps ensure a smooth visa approval process. Most colleges require full or partial payment of your first-year tuition fees.
Typical cost:
CAD $12,000–$25,000 per year
5. SOP (Statement of Purpose)
A Statement of Purpose (SOP) is an essential requirement for studying in Canada, as it helps visa officers understand a student’s academic background, study goals, and reasons for choosing Canada. A strong SOP clearly explains program relevance, future career plans, and the student’s intention to return home after completing their studies. It plays a key role in demonstrating genuine study intentions for the study permit process.
A strong SOP is critical for visa success. You must clearly explain:
-
Why Canada?
-
Why your chosen program?
-
Your academic & career goals
-
Family ties and intention to return
-
Financial support
A well-written SOP greatly improves your Canada student visa from Bangladesh approval chances.
6. Proof of Funds (Outside of GIC)
IRCC requires evidence of your financial ability such as:
-
6-month bank statements
-
Parent/sponsor income documents
-
TIN certificate
-
Tax returns
-
Salary slips
-
Business documents
7. Medical Exam
You must complete a medical exam through an IRCC-approved panel physician in Dhaka.
8. Biometrics
Mandatory at the Canada Visa Application Centre (VAC) in Dhaka.
9. Valid Passport & Photographs
Passport must be valid for the entire study duration.
10. Visa Application Submission
Apply online through the IRCC portal and upload all documents.
Processing time: 4–10 weeks
Following these requirements significantly increases your chances of successfully obtaining a Canada student visa from Bangladesh.

Tuition Fees for Bangladeshi Students in Canada
Understanding tuition fees is crucial when applying for a Canada student visa from Bangladesh.
| Program Level | Annual Fees (CAD) |
|---|---|
| Diploma | 12,000 – 18,000 |
| Bachelor’s | 18,000–28,000 |
| Master’s | 15,000–40,000 |
| PhD | 10,000–25,000 |
Engineering, medicine, and tech programs generally cost more.

Living Cost in Canada for Bangladeshi Students
Living cost depends on city and lifestyle. IRCC’s expected living cost per year is:
CAD $20,635
Monthly Breakdown
| Expense | Cost (CAD) |
|---|---|
| Rent | 500–1,200 |
| Food | 200–350 |
| Transport | 80–150 |
| Utilities | 100–150 |
| Phone/Internet | 50–90 |
Affordable cities include Winnipeg, Regina, and Halifax.
Toronto and Vancouver are more expensive but offer better jobs.
Job Opportunities in Canada for Students
During studies, students can work:
- 20 hours per week
during semesters
- Full-time
during holidays
Popular Student Jobs
-
Retail assistant
-
Food service
-
Customer support
-
Warehouse crew
-
Cleaner
-
Tutor
-
Office assistant
Hourly Wage
CAD $16–$22
Part-time jobs help cover living expenses while studying under a Canada student visa from Bangladesh.
Job Opportunities After Graduation (PGWP)
After completing your program, the post-graduation work permit allows you to work legally.
PGWP Duration
-
1-year program → 1-year work permit
-
2-year program → 3-year work permit
High-Demand Sectors
| Sector | Salary Range (CAD) |
|---|---|
| IT & Software | 65,000 – 120,000 |
| Engineering | 60,000 – 110,000 |
| Healthcare | 55,000 – 100,000 |
| Data Science | 80,000–130,000 |
| Finance | 50,000–90,000 |
| Hospitality | 35,000 – 60,000 |
Most PGWP graduates later qualify for PR under Express Entry or PNP.
Schooling in Canada for Bangladeshi Families
Parents with a study permit can bring dependent children.
- Public Schools
FREE for children if the parent holds a valid study or work permit.
- Private Schools
CAD $10,000–$20,000 per year
Canadian schools focus heavily on skill development, sports, creativity, and leadership.
